CSS Frameworks
CSS frameworks are pre-designed and pre-written collections of CSS code that provide a foundation for developers to build responsive and visually appealing websites quickly and efficiently. These frameworks typically include a grid system, typography styles, color schemes, UI components, and other common design elements that can be easily customized and extended.
Using a CSS framework can save time and effort for developers, as they don't have to write CSS from scratch or worry about browser compatibility and responsive design. They can focus on building the website's functionality and customizing the design to meet their specific needs.
CSS frameworks can be used with various front-end technologies, such as HTML, JavaScript, and other CSS preprocessors, and can be integrated with popular web development tools, such as code editors, task runners, and build systems.
Some popular CSS frameworks include Bootstrap, Foundation, Bulma, Materialize, and Semantic UI. They are widely used by developers of all skill levels and can be helpful in creating consistent and modern designs for websites and web applications.
Bootstrap is a popular free and open-source CSS framework that is specifically designed for building responsive and mobile-first front-end web applications. It provides a comprehensive set of HTML, CSS, and JavaScript-based design templates for a wide range of interface components, including typography, forms, buttons, navigation, and more. With its pre-built and customizable UI components, Bootstrap allows developers to rapidly prototype and build modern and responsive web applications, without having to start from scratch. The framework is highly configurable and can be customized to match any design or branding requirements, making it a popular choice among developers who are looking for a quick and efficient way to build modern web applications. Additionally, Bootstrap's mobile-first approach ensures that web applications built with the framework are optimized for viewing on all types of devices, including smartphones, tablets, and desktop computers. With its powerful and flexible set of features, Bootstrap has become one of the most popular CSS frameworks available today, and is used by developers all over the world to build modern and responsive web applications.
Tailwind CSS is an open source CSS framework that is designed to provide a highly customizable and flexible approach to styling web applications. Unlike other CSS frameworks, such as Bootstrap, Tailwind CSS does not provide a set of predefined classes for common UI elements like buttons or tables. Instead, Tailwind CSS provides a comprehensive set of utility classes that can be combined and customized to create any desired style or layout. This allows developers to rapidly prototype and design responsive web applications, without being constrained by pre-built UI components. Tailwind CSS is highly configurable and can be customized to match any design or branding requirements, making it a popular choice among developers who are looking for a more flexible and dynamic approach to styling their web applications. With its powerful and extensible set of features, Tailwind CSS has become a go-to choice for developers who want to build modern and responsive web applications that are optimized for performance and scalability.